  • Patent number: 7383951
    Abstract: A pallet can be detachably carried on a sled for shipping heavier objects on the pallet as carried by the sled, or lighter object on the pallet alone, the sled spreading the weight over a greater area than the pallet alone. The dimensions of both the pallet and sled are related to contribute different integer fractions of a given dimension such as the length of a standard intermodal container. This arrangement is apt for shipping smaller steel coils on pallets and larger steel coils on pallets carried by sleds. Thus, for example, quarter-container-length pallets, normally appropriate for a pallet to carry lighter coils, can carry heavier loads on a sled occupying a larger proportion of the container length, such as a half-container-length sled. An attachment mechanism affixes the sled to the pallet and the assembly is configured for manipulation with a fork lift.
